Today in Country Music, June 19.
On this day in 2011, it was Rascal Flatts' kick off weekend of the "Flatts Fest" concert series with revolving opening acts that included Sara Evans, Justin Moore and Easton Corbin.
Today in 2007, Brad Paisley's 5th Gear landed in stores… the album featured the hits "Ticks" as well as "I'm Still A Guy."
In 2006, Gretchen Wilson and Josh Gracin performed for George W. Bush and 6,000 guests at the president's dinner at the Washington Convention Center.
And on this day in 1982, Conway Twitty's version of "Slow Hand" grabbed the top position on the Billboard country singles chart.
Slow Hand was written by John Bettis and Michael Clark and first recorded by the Pointer Sisters. It was first released in the spring of 1981
“Slow Hand” was covered in 1982 by Conway Twitty. His version, on Elektra Records, topped the Billboard Hot Country Singles chart for two weeks that June, and was his last multi-week number-one song.
